Smell for in the first two cases is similar. Smell in the last case is different:

First: Thread starter's case, there is a oil leakage. Its an arcid burning smell. the crankshaft seal is spraying the oil all over and the exhaust manifold becomes red hot. Thats why the thread starter is getting the smell from the exhaust.

In Swiftrazak's case, its again oil leakage.It should be a leaky valve cover. And all this oil drizzles on the exhaust and gets vaporized immediately and thats the smoke.

In Rammishra's case, its leaky injectors. After driving the car after 2-3 days, he gets the smell. The petrol in this heat leaks out from his injector/injection line or a fuel tank vent hose. and this problem disappears after sometime. so it has to be petrol leaking. Doesn't it smell like the one at a petrol pump?

If it doesn't, then do revert.
